Transfer of Cases Between Courts Made Easier
Posted on Wednesday, August 17, 2005 - 09:54 AM
The Subordinate Courts Act was amended on 15 August 2005 to allow for cases to be easily transferred from the Subordinate Courts to the High Court and visa versa as well as between the District Court and Magistrates Court and visa versa.
The basic objective is to provide for greater flexibility to the courts to transfer proceedings between themselves so that cases may be dealt with as efficiently as possible. The amendments also seeks to remove anomalies and resolve certain shortcomings highlighted in recent decisions of the Singapore Supreme Court, so that transfers of
civil proceedings between courts will be less complex and more flexible.
